- High-Intensity Illumination: The primary advantage of the Psolar 150w light projector is its ability to cast a bright and far-reaching beam. This makes it suitable for lighting up sizable areas such as gardens, parking lots, and event spaces. The intensity of the light ensures visibility and safety, significantly reducing the risk of accidents or security breaches.
- Energy Efficiency: Psolar projectors are engineered for energy efficiency. This means you get brilliant illumination without racking up exorbitant electricity bills. They typically employ LED technology, which is known for its low energy consumption compared to traditional lighting solutions. This not only saves you money but also reduces your carbon footprint, making it an environmentally responsible choice.
- Durability and Weather Resistance: Outdoor lighting needs to withstand the elements, and Psolar projectors are built to do just that. Constructed with robust materials and weather-resistant seals, these projectors can endure rain, snow, heat, and dust. This ensures consistent performance and a long lifespan, making them a worthwhile investment for both residential and commercial applications. The sturdy build is a key feature that sets Psolar apart from less durable alternatives.
- Ease of Installation: Setting up Psolar projectors is typically straightforward. Most models come with adjustable brackets and clear instructions, allowing for easy mounting on walls, poles, or other surfaces. This ease of installation minimizes setup time and costs, making it a user-friendly option for both DIY enthusiasts and professional installers.
- Versatile Applications: The versatility of Psolar 150w light projectors makes them suitable for a wide range of applications. From enhancing the ambiance of outdoor events to providing security lighting for commercial properties, these projectors can adapt to various needs. Their ability to create dramatic lighting effects also makes them popular for architectural lighting and landscaping, adding aesthetic value to any space.
- LED Type and Brightness: Not all LEDs are created equal. Look for projectors that use high-quality LED chips known for their brightness and longevity. The brightness is typically measured in lumens, so the higher the lumens, the brighter the light. Also, consider the color temperature (measured in Kelvin). Warmer temperatures (around 2700-3000K) create a cozy, inviting atmosphere, while cooler temperatures (4000-5000K) provide a crisp, clear light that’s ideal for security purposes.
- Beam Angle: The beam angle determines how wide the light spreads. A wider beam angle is perfect for illuminating large areas, while a narrower beam angle is better for spotlighting specific objects or features. Consider what you want to illuminate and choose a beam angle that suits your needs. Some projectors also come with adjustable beam angles, giving you even more flexibility.
- IP Rating: The Ingress Protection (IP) rating indicates how well the projector is protected against dust and water. For outdoor use, you’ll want a projector with an IP rating of at least IP65, which means it’s protected against dust and water jets. Higher IP ratings offer even greater protection, making the projector suitable for more demanding environments. Always check the IP rating to ensure the projector can withstand the weather conditions in your area.
- Housing Material: The housing material affects the projector's durability and resistance to corrosion. Look for projectors with housings made from high-quality aluminum or other durable materials. These materials can withstand the elements and protect the internal components from damage. Also, consider the finish of the housing, as some finishes are more resistant to scratches and fading.
- Cooling System: High-power LEDs generate heat, so an efficient cooling system is essential to prevent overheating and prolong the lifespan of the projector. Look for projectors with built-in heat sinks or fans that dissipate heat effectively. A good cooling system will ensure that the projector operates at optimal temperatures, maintaining its brightness and efficiency over time. Efficient cooling is vital for the long-term performance of the projector.
- Security Lighting: One of the most popular uses is for security. Positioned strategically around your property, these projectors can deter intruders and enhance safety. The bright light can illuminate dark corners and pathways, making it easier to spot potential threats. Motion-activated projectors are particularly effective for security, as they automatically turn on when someone approaches, startling intruders and alerting you to their presence.
- Landscape Lighting: Want to show off your garden or architectural features at night? Psolar projectors can highlight trees, shrubs, and building facades, creating a stunning visual display. Use different colors and beam angles to create dramatic effects and add depth to your landscape. Up-lighting trees, for example, can create a sense of grandeur, while spotlighting a fountain can add a touch of elegance.
- Event Lighting: Planning an outdoor event? These projectors can create a festive atmosphere and ensure that guests can see clearly. Use them to light up dance floors, stages, and seating areas. Colored lights can add to the ambiance and create a memorable experience. For example, you could use blue lights for a cool, calming effect or red lights for a high-energy, exciting atmosphere.
- Commercial Lighting: Businesses can use Psolar projectors to light up parking lots, loading docks, and building exteriors. This enhances safety and security for employees and customers. Properly lit commercial spaces also create a more professional and inviting atmosphere, which can improve customer perception and boost sales. Additionally, energy-efficient lighting can help businesses save money on their electricity bills.
- Sports and Recreation: Light up sports courts, fields, and recreational areas for nighttime activities. This allows you to enjoy your favorite sports even after the sun goes down. Whether it's a game of basketball, a tennis match, or a nighttime swim, Psolar projectors can provide the illumination you need to stay active and have fun. Just make sure to position the lights strategically to avoid glare and ensure even coverage.
- Choose the Right Location: Consider what you want to illuminate and choose a location that provides the best coverage. Avoid placing the projector where it will shine directly into people's eyes or create glare. Also, make sure the location is easily accessible for maintenance and adjustments.
- Mounting Considerations: Ensure the mounting surface is strong enough to support the weight of the projector. Use appropriate hardware and foll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ully. If you're mounting the projector on a pole or wall, make sure it's securely anchored to prevent it from falling. For added safety, use a safety cable to secure the projector to the mounting surface.
- Wiring and Electrical Connections: If you're not comfortable working with electricity, hire a qualified electrician to handle the wiring and electrical connections. Always follow local electrical codes and regulations. Use weatherproof connectors and conduits to protect the wiring from the elements. Before making any connections, make sure the power is turned off to prevent electric shock.
- Aiming and Adjustments: Once the projector is mounted, take the time to aim and adjust the beam angle to achieve the desired effect. Use a level to ensure the projector is properly aligned. Experiment with different angles and positions to find the optimal setup. If the projector has adjustable brightness settings, fine-tune them to create the perfect level of illumination.
- Maintenance: Regularly inspect the projector for any signs of damage or wear. Clean the lens with a soft cloth to remove dust and debris. Check the wiring and electrical connections to ensure they're secure and in good condition. Replace any damaged components promptly to prevent further damage. By performing regular maintenance, you can extend the lifespan of your projector and keep it performing at its best.
